    The Story Behind Liandro

    Liandro is a name with Greek roots, derived from the elements 'leon' (lion) and 'andros' (man). It shares its etymological lineage with names like Leander, which has a long history in classical literature and mythology. The name evokes strength, courage, and leadership, qualities often associated with the lion.

    While not as widely known as its variant Leander, Liandro has seen usage in various cultures, particularly in Romance language-speaking regions, where the 'i' often replaces the 'e' in similar names. Its distinct sound gives it a unique charm while retaining its powerful ancient meaning.
